- The distance between Minna, Nigeria and Shingle Point, Yt, Canada is approximately 10,836 km or 6,734 mi.
- To reach Minna in this distance one would set out from Shingle Point, Yt bearing 36°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Minna bearing 167.6° or SSE .
- Minna has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Shingle Point, Yt has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
- Minna is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Shingle Point, Yt is in or near the subpolar moist tundra biome.
- The average annual temperature is 36.9 °C (66.5°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 31.5 °C (56.7°F) less in Minna.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 978.7 mm (38.5 in) more which is equivalent to 978.7 l/m² (24.02 US gal/ft²) or 9,787,000 l/ha (1,046,295 US gal/ac) more. About 5 1/4 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 52.4° higher in Minna than in Shingle Point, Yt.
